Must-Have Travel Documents
When getting ready to pack clothing or electronics, your travel documents will need to come first.
Essential Travel Documents
- Valid passport (valid for 6+ months).
- Visas (if applicable).
- Driver’s license / International Driving Permit.Printed flight and accommodation bookings.
- Travel insurance (both printed and digital copy).
- Emergency contact information.
- Health/Vaccine Certificates.

Pro Tip: Save copies of all the documents in Google Drive, Dropbox, or a similar app, and keep a few printed copies in different bags.

Toiletries and Hygiene Travel Kit
Your travel toiletries should be compact, organized, and TSA compliant.
Toiletry Bag Checklist
- Tooth brush + tooth paste.
- Shampoo/conditioner (travel size).
- Razor.
- Deodorant.
- Moisturizer + sunscreen.
- Lip balm.
- Feminine hygiene products.
- Travel towel.
- First aid (Band-Aids, antiseptic)
Toiletry Packing Tips
- Use leak proof travel bottles.
- Store liquids in a clear zip-lock bag.
- Pack solid toiletries (ex. shampoo bars) to get around the liquid restrictions!

Packing Hacks for Efficient Travel
Become a master at smart packing with these pro tips:
Smart Packing Tips
- Roll your clothes to save space.
- Packing cubes can help.
- Use the 3-2-1 rule (3 tops, 2 bottoms, 1 dressy outfit).
- Pack heavy items closest to the suitcase wheels.
- Weigh your bag before going to the airport.
